@WriterOfTheNight I've raised 6 kids, THAT's been interesting.

I've built a career that normally requires a lot more education than I actually have. I'm a high school grad, I've led teams where the people working for me all had masters degrees. THAT's been interesting. I built this career by teaching myself, programming, electronics, and higher math.

I've been married twice. Once to a toxic narcissist. THAT was interesting. A second time to one of the sweetest people I've ever known. It's interesting to have this almost saintly person to compare yourself to.

So, yes, I'd call my life interesting.

@WriterOfTheNight The concept of a subject being "interesting'" is extraordinarily subjective and varies greatly between people. A lot of things I find interesting most dont and vice versa. My life is not particularly interesting to me, though that could just be the normalization of a lot of things that aren't normal due to constant exposure. Of course I'd never be able to tell between whats normal and whats not as its all the same to me. Hmm but I do suppose one thing that does give my life a tad bit of uniqueness is that I have schizophrenia. Did you know it only affects less than 1% of the population? And early onset of it is even more rare, yet I got both. An early onset of schizophrenia. A mystery indeed. And on top of that, I find rarely any stories or experiences of people with disease itself. Even with its rarity, some stories should be evident. There are some famous people who've suffered from it, such as son of Albert Einstein, Eduard Einstein. But nothing about their actual experiences and both maddening and intriguing. Especially since this disability certainly does change a lot of things, at least for me, causing me to experience things vert differently than other people. A curse, but an utterly intriguing one
